Generator Install questions, answered by experts

The average cost to install a home generator is $5,200, but total costs can range from $500 to $18,000 or more. The final price depends on several factors, including the generator's size, type, brand, fuel source, and the cost of labor and assembly. The generator's size is the most significant cost factor, as units that can power larger homes with higher energy demands cost more.

Cost breakdowns by generator type are typically as follows:

  • Portable or Emergency Backup Generators (1kW–7.5kW): $500–$2,000

  • Partial-Home Generators (9kW–20kW): $2,000–$6,500

  • Whole-House Generators (22kW–48kW): $5,000–$18,000

To ensure you get the right size unit for your needs without overpaying, consider hiring an electrician to calculate the electrical load of your essential appliances. It is also recommended to get at least three quotes from qualified installers to find the best fit for your budget.

Generators run on a variety of fuel types, ranging from natural gas to solar power. Keep in mind that fuel costs varying by type:

  • Natural gas: $2,000–$21,000 per year 

  • Liquid propane: $2,000–$21,000 per year

  • Diesel: $3,000–$20,000 per year

  • Gasoline: $500–$3,000 per year

  • Solar generator: $2,000–$25,000 per unit

  • Battery backup: $10,000–$25,000 per unit

Whole-house generators can run continuously for extended periods, even for weeks at a time (around 400 to 500 hours), as long as they have a sufficient fuel supply. However, this type of extensive use will increase wear and tear and can shorten the generator's overall lifespan. During long periods of operation, it's important to check and refill the engine oil as needed, potentially as frequently as daily depending on the model. If your generator uses a fuel tank, ensure it is kept full to prevent unexpected shutdowns.

Generally, you’ll want to keep between 60 and 70 feet between the generator and the transfer switch. There are a few reasons for this, including:

  • The distance reduces the noise coming from the generator into your home.

  • It increases efficiency because you won’t have a voltage drop from this short of a distance.

  • Prevents carbon monoxide poisoning: keep at least 15 feet between your generator and an open window. 

Sizing a generator is a careful process that requires calculating the electrical load of your entire house. You have to take into account every device you want to use and their wattage requirements, plus the wattage needed to start them, and look for a generator that can safely run all that at around 80% capacity.

In more practical terms, a small home can run on a 10,000-watt generator (and if you only want to power a few key appliances, much less than that). A mid-sized home may need something between 15,000 and 22,000 watts. Larger homes require 25,000 watts or more.
